Justice Minister Helen McEntee has offered her condolences to the family of a woman who died after a “horrific” dog attack in Limerick yesterday.
Gardaí say the dog behind the attack “has now been destroyed” and other dogs at the residence have also been seized.“I want to acknowledge this is a really horrific incident and offer my condolences to the woman’s family,” she said. “We also need to make sure that if there are breeds of animals here that people shouldn’t have, are not safe, or pose a threat that that’s made clear.”Social Protection Minister Heather Humphreys also paid tribute to the“I want to begin by expressing my deepest sympathies to her family in what is a deeply shocking incident," she said.“I have consistently said that more action is required in relation to dog control.
